PLASTER

/ˈplɑːstə/7 letters

Definition of PLASTER

noun

A paste applied to the skin for healing or cosmetic purposes.

Where it comes from

From Middle English plaster, plastre, from Old English plaster, from late Latin plastrum, shortened from Classical Latin emplastrum (“a plaster, bandage”); later reinforced by Anglo-Norman plastre. Displaced native Old English clīþa. The verb is from Middle English plastren, from the noun.
